Add Handle/HandleScope and delete SirtRef.

Delete SirtRef and replaced it with Handle. Handles are value types
which wrap around StackReference*.

Renamed StackIndirectReferenceTable to HandleScope.

Added a scoped handle wrapper which wraps around an Object** and
restores it in its destructor.

Renamed Handle::get -> Get.
